METB-10. EVALUATION OF NON-SUPERVISED MATRIX-ASSISTED LASER DESORPTION / IONIZATION MASS SPECTROMETRY IMAGING (MALDI) MASS SPECTROMETRY IMAGING (MSI) COMBINED WITH MICROPROTEOMICS FOR DETERMINATION OF GLIOBLASTOMA HETEROGENEITY

The aim of the GLIOMIC study (NCT 02473484) is to identify prognostic subgroups of glioblastoma by Matrix-assisted laser desorption/ionization mass spectrometry imaging (MALDI-MSI) followed by tissue micro-extraction and unsupervised clustering.
